Output 58be947abe396e84343ecd517f5a68550ad4fdcc7ba8aeead4b1afc18d56f20f:0

value
812185566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9eb52de63c2d2d3edb31fb94a0ae98a0d5b93abf OP_EQUAL
address
3GABjQnwSmLHZ73nPiPYZn4eHP2qhpt6L2
transaction
58be947abe396e84343ecd517f5a68550ad4fdcc7ba8aeead4b1afc18d56f20f
spent
true